This 16-yr-old’s mom plays the ultimate Pokémon Go trick on him

Renzo Huamanchumo got trolled by his mother who used his Pokémon Go obsession to get him to take her dirty dishes down.

Renzo Huamanchumo, a 16-year-old high school student from California, got owned by his mother, thanks to his obsession with Pokémon Go! His mother noticed him obsessing over the widely popular game and decided to get him to do some work, using his obsession. Here’s how.

She first messaged him asking the kid about his whereabouts, and then raising an alarm saying that there was a Pikachu in her room.

 

Renzo obviously got excited and ran to his mother’s room to catch Pikachu, only to find out that she wanted him to take her dirty dishes down!

 

The teenager posted about his mother’s funny prank on Twitter, and his tweet got retweeted by parody account @girlposts, where it got retweeted more than 10,000 times within a couple of hours. And that’s how Renzo’s mother’s prank became famous on the Internet!

 

 

Renzo’s mother reportedly was amused by the reactions her prank was getting on social media and laughed hard about it!
